在用glibc取代glibc之后,系统根本没有任何区域。我已经切换回glibc,它是相同的(没有地区)。试着恢复我得到的地方:
# locale-gen
Generating locales...
error: Bad entry 'C '
error: Bad entry 'POSIX '
error: Bad entry 'de_DE.utf8 '
error: Bad entry 'en_US.utf8 '
Generation complete.系统: Arch Linux
glibc: 2.26-11.0
/etc/locale.conf
LANG=de_DE.UTF-8
LC_CTYPE=de_DE.UTF-8
LC_NUMERIC=de_DE.UTF-8
LC_TIME=de_DE.UTF-8
LC_COLLATE=C
LC_MONETARY=de_DE.UTF-8
LC_MESSAGES=de_DE.UTF-8
LC_PAPER=de_DE.UTF-8
LC_NAME=de_DE.UTF-8
LC_ADDRESS=de_DE.UTF-8
LC_TELEPHONE=de_DE.UTF-8
LC_MEASUREMENT=de_DE.UTF-8
LC_IDENTIFICATION="de_DE.UTF-8"/etc/locale.gen
C
POSIX
de_DE.utf8
en_US.utf8提前感谢!
发布于 2018-04-22 16:15:56
locale.gen的正确语法是:
de_DE.UTF-8 UTF-8
en_US.UTF-8 UTF-8问题解决了!
https://unix.stackexchange.com/questions/439271
复制相似问题